KCR’s comments in Achampet public meeting

During the Achampet public meet, KCR stated that the BRS government is working towards the welfare and development of all sections of people. He emphasised that if the people defeat BRS in the upcoming election, it won’t be a personal loss for them but will affect the public and cause suffering. Therefore, he advised people to be careful when casting their votes. As a party that played a crucial role in the formation of Telangana, he mentioned that it is their responsibility to inform the citizens about these matters. KCR added that only the Telangana government provides farmers with 24-hour free electricity, which is unique in the entire country. He said Rythu Bandhu and Dalit Bandhu schemes implementation credit is BRS, which is the only party implementing such schemes. He urged people to exhibit wisdom through their voting choices by rejecting parties and leaders who believe they can achieve anything with money.

If defeated! : Such comments are not first time from KCR

Opposition parties are criticizing KCR for his recent comments suggesting that if they lose the election, the people will suffer. Congress leaders claim that KCR is making these remarks out of fear of defeat and are accusing him of emotionally manipulating the public. This is not the first time KCR has made such comments; he also made similar statements during the 2018 election campaign. At that time, KCR stated that if he were to lose, it would be a loss for the people, and he would take rest in his farmhouse. KCR’s opponent parties, especially Rahul Gandhi, responded by saying ‘KCR ji, you take rest, we will show you the development model.’ In that election, BRS achieved a significant victory with 88 seats, leaving the Congress with only 19 seats. As the upcoming election approaches, it remains to be seen which party will be given rest by the people and which party will come into power.
